Star Trek movie stuff in PS Home today

Enterprising plans for rest of April.

Paramount Pictures and Sony are bringing the new Star Trek movie into PlayStation Home.

Starting today, there will be a video greeting by director JJ Abrams to watch plus a brand new trailer for the film, which stars British funny-man Simon Pegg as Scotty.

Then, from 23rd April, there will be Starfleet costumes and t-shirts to deck avatars out in, according to Kotaku.

But before that, on 20th April, fans will be able to join Abrams and Star Trek stars Chris Pine (Kirk) and Zachary Quinto (Spock) for a live Q&A session inside PlayStation Home. Selected press will ask the questions from 4pm GMT, and the event will be webcast on the Star Trek PlayStation Home website.

Star Trek opens in cinemas here on 8th May. Eurogamer's Johnny Minkley - friend to the stars - went to watch at a media premiere last night.
